The Xperia 5 III has a general score of 90.5, which is better than the Moto G9 Play's score of 76.7. These phones work with Android OS (Operating System), but Xperia 5 III has a more recent 11 version and Moto G9 Play has Android 10, giving some nice extra features and performance enhancements. Xperia 5 III is a lighter and thinner phone than Moto G9 Play, even though both of them were released with only a couple of months difference.
Xperia 5 III counts with a better screen than Motorola Moto G9 Play, because although it has a bit smaller display, it also counts with a way higher 1080 x 2520 resolution and a much greater display pixels density. Xperia 5 III has a much bigger memory for applications and games than Motorola Moto G9 Play, because it has an external SD slot that admits up to 1 TB and 192 GB more internal memory capacity.
The Xperia 5 III counts with just a little better hardware performance than Motorola Moto G9 Play, and although they both have the same number of cores, the Xperia 5 III also has more RAM. The Motorola Moto G9 Play counts with a little bit better camera than Xperia 5 III, because although it has slower 60 frames per second video frame rates, and they both have a 0.59 inches back-facing camera sensor, the same camera aperture and the same (Full HD) video quality, the Motorola Moto G9 Play also counts with a much higher 48 mega-pixels resolution back facing camera.
Motorola Moto G9 Play counts with a bit superior battery life than Xperia 5 III, because it has a 5000mAh battery capacity against 4500mAh.
